How Old Can A Baby Fly On A Plane. Most airlines stipulate that your baby must be at least 14 days old before they board their first flight. On delta or at a reduced fare for international travel. How old should a baby be to fly? There’s no official age when experts say it’s okay for your baby to fly. When is my baby old enough to fly on an airplane? If you are traveling with a newborn child very shortly after birth, be aware that there are age restrictions on the minimum age you can fly. Infants or children under 2 years of age can travel on the lap of an adult for free within the u.s. How old does a baby have to be to fly? 35 rows how old does a baby need to be before they can fly? Air travel may not be a good idea for babies. Generally, you should avoid flying with your newborn until they are at least 7 days old. That said, the american academy of pediatrics (aap) discourages newborns from flying unnecessarily after birth, since air travel can increase a young baby’s risk for catching an infectious disease. Ideally, wait until your baby is two or three months old to fly.
